A Community-Based Construct Method for an Inter-Satellite Communication Network of Satellite Swarm.
Weicheng Lun1, Qun Li1, Can Zhang1
1College of Systems Engineering, National University of Defense Technology, Changsha 410073, China.
This study introduces a new method for building satellite communication networks. It uses network theory and structural entropy to create robust inter-satellite communication networks (ICNS) for satellite swarms.
Area of Science:
- Space Technology
- Network Science
- Complex Systems
Background:
- Inter-satellite communication networks (ICNS) are crucial for satellite swarms.
- Current methods for constructing ICNS can be improved for dynamic connectivity.
Purpose of the Study:
- To develop a novel algorithm for constructing ICNS from pre-link networks (PLN).
- To introduce a new metric, structural entropy, for evaluating candidate link communities.
- To ensure the dynamic connectivity of the ICNS.
Main Methods:
- Modeling satellite swarms as pre-link networks (PLN).
- Generating combinations of candidates for link communities (CCLC).
- Employing a sampling algorithm and structural entropy to select the optimal CCLC.
- Implementing an improvement method to maintain dynamic network connectivity.
Main Results:
- A new algorithm effectively constructs ICNS by selecting CCLCs based on maximum structural entropy.
- The proposed improvement method ensures the ICNS remains a dynamic connected network.
- Simulations show the method outperforms existing benchmark approaches.
Conclusions:
- The developed method provides an effective approach for building robust ICNS for satellite swarms.
- Structural entropy is a valuable metric for evaluating network structures in this context.
- The improvement method is essential for maintaining dynamic connectivity in ICNS.
